Chapter 8.43 - Verse 60

Sanskrit Text

निर्मनुष्यान्गजानश्वान्रथांश्चैव धनंजय समाद्रवन्ति पाञ्चाला धार्तराष्ट्रांस्तरस्विनः

English Translation

There the quick-coursing Panchalas, O Dhananjaya, are rushing against the elephants, horses and cars belonging the Dhritarashtra's party, divested of their riders. O foremost of men, O slayer of enemies, your warriors, giving up the love of their lives and invincible in battle, are, aided by Bhimasena's power, grinding the enemy's army.

Padaccheda (Word Analysis)

निर्मनुष्यान् | गजान् | अश्वान् | रथांश् | च + एव | धनंजय
समाद्रवन्ति | पाञ्चाला | धार्तराष्ट्रांस् | तरस्विनः
